左右值
2015-12-09 16:46
204 查看
左值 右值
int a = 3;
int *ap = &a;
&a 右值
*ap 左值
可以取地址的为左值
不可取地址的为右值
例:
T& fun1(){
T t;
return t;//自动取址
}
int a = 3;
int *ap = &a;
&a 右值
*ap 左值
可以取地址的为左值
不可取地址的为右值
例:
T& fun1(){
T t;
return t;//自动取址
}
相关文章推荐
- C++内存分配方式详解——堆、栈、自由存储区、全局/静态存储区和常量存储区
- marquee 轮播滚动吧span、img、div!!
- .net(c#)操作IIS大全
- Android Animation学习笔记
- java http调用方式get post 包含带header
- Theano数据类型--TypeError
- 面向无连接和面向连接的最主要区别是什么?
- 利用Ajax增删改Sharepoint List Item
- 夺命雷公狗---Smarty NO:12 section函数
- Java反射xml数据类
- 洛湃小诗
- [javase学习笔记]-2.3 注释
- JS nodeType返回类型
- h5与原生代码交互
- 设计模式之适配器模式
- 制作各种效果的动态图
- jquery.js和jquery.min.js的区别介绍
- C#中Timer使用及解决重入问题
- go-nsq使用简述
- 关于屏幕适配的一些看法